Poly Lifting services involve the use of specialized equipment to lift, level, or reposition concrete slabs, driveways, patios, and other flat surfaces. This process typically employs polyurethane foam or other lightweight, high-strength materials to raise sunken or uneven surfaces back to their original position. The technique is designed to be minimally invasive, avoiding the need for extensive demolition or replacement, which can save time and reduce disruption for property owners.
This service helps address common problems such as uneven walkways, cracked or sinking driveways, and uneven patios that can pose safety hazards or diminish curb appeal. Over time, soil movement, tree roots, or poor initial construction can cause concrete surfaces to settle or shift, creating tripping hazards or water drainage issues. Poly Lifting offers a practical solution to restore the stability and appearance of these surfaces without the need for complete replacement.

What is poly lifting? Poly lifting involves raising and supporting structures or objects using specialized polyurethane foam to provide stability during repairs or renovations.
How do poly lifting services work? Local service providers use foam injection techniques to lift and stabilize elements such as slabs, floors, or foundations as part of their repair or leveling solutions.
What types of projects can benefit from poly lifting? Poly lifting is commonly used for leveling uneven concrete slabs, raising sunken floors, or stabilizing foundation elements in residential and commercial properties.
Is poly lifting suitable for all types of surfaces? Poly lifting is effective on many surfaces, including concrete, asphalt, and other solid materials, but a professional assessment is recommended to determine suitability.
